Job Reference: JJ1560662LonAHBPLocation: Milton Keynes, Buckinghamshire, United KingdomType of Contract: PermanentSalary: 0Join Dandara: Where Your Expertise Shapes Our SuccessAt Dandara, our people are at the heart of everything we do. We believe the best ideas come from collaboration, and were passionate about creating a workplace where innovation, integrity, employee voice and customer focus thrive. By joining us, youll be part of a forward-thinking team, driving meaningful change and helping to build vibrant communities.The RoleAs our Assistant HR Business Partner, youll play a key role in supporting our teams across the Isle of Man, Ireland and Jersey, acting as a trusted HR contact for these regions. Youll work closely with managers and employees, providing practical, hands-on HR support while also contributing to wider people initiatives across the business.This is a varied role where no two days look the same youll balance day-to-day HR activity with opportunities to get involved in projects, build strong stakeholder relationships and make a genuine impact. This role can be based either in our London office or our Milton Keynes office.Location & Working Pattern Based within commutable distance of Milton Keynes office 12 days per week inMilton Keynes or London office. Monday Friday, 37.5 hours per weekTravel RequirementsThis role involves regular travel, so its important youre comfortable with this aspect: Travel to the Isle of Man and Jersey approximately once per month Typically one visit per location, including a minimum of 2 overnight stays per trip Travel is fully supported and funded by Dandara, with flexibility to work remotely between visitsWhy This Role? Variety & Impact Youll support a range of HR activities, from employee relations to engagement and development, making a real difference to our teams. Exposure & Development Youll work closely with our HR Business Partner, Group HR Director and wider HR team, gaining valuable experience to support your development. Autonomy & Responsibility Youll be trusted to manage your workload and build strong relationships across your regions, while having the support of a collaborative HR team behind you.Your Role at a GlanceYoull support across the full employee lifecycle, including: Providing guidance on employee relations, including performance, absence, disciplinary and grievance matters Supporting organisational change processes, including restructures, TUPE and redundancy, ensuring a fair and consistent approach Supporting onboarding and offboarding processes and maintaining accurate HR data Delivering practical, face-to-face HR training to your regions alongside our Learning & Development Manager Assisting with HR reporting and metrics, identifying trends and supporting decision-making Supporting policy implementation and compliance with employment legislation Contributing to performance and development processes, including reviews and training initiatives Working closely with the wider HR team on projects and continuous improvement initiativesWhat You Bring Previous HR experience, ideally within Construction, Property, Engineering or similar environments (preferable) CIPD Level 5 (or working towards) A proactive, organised approach with the ability to manage competing priorities Strong communication skills and confidence building relationships at all levels Experience using HR systems and working with dataWhats in It for You?We offer a competitive package, including: Competitive salary based on experience Car allowance Discretionary bonus, private medical insurance and life assurance (x3) 33 days holiday (including bank holidays) + option to buy more Employer-matched pension (up to 5%) Health & wellbeing support (EAP, Health Hero, Wisdom App) Flexible benefits including cycle to work, EV scheme and retail discounts Ongoing development opportunities within a growing business
